My new role as London Unity League Chairman

On Thursday, the London Unity League (LUL) – a LGBT-friendly league based in London – elected me League Chairman. I was looking for a new role in LGBT-friendly football and was keen to provide my support to the league. I took Bexley Invicta FC into the LUL in 2012 and it has proved to be a great league for football and for socialising. I want to see the league continue to thrive, and to play my part in ensuring that it meets the expectations of clubs and players.

Following my election, I messaged the LUL clubs to say: “Thank you so much for electing me as chairman of the LUL. I’m delighted to have this opportunity to service the league and constituent clubs.”

I sent a further message this morning: “As your new league chairman, I make the clubs two initial pledges. First, I will be accessible. Contact me on my mobile number or [personal email address] if there is anything you wish to discuss. Second, I intend to be visible, including coming along to fixtures as the season progresses to check in with clubs and players about how you think the league is going, and any concerns or ideas you may have.”
